Trashed iPhone Docking Station
As a part of this iPhone hack I ended up ripping apart my iPhone dock to solve a mystery about what pins are used. Let's just say the dock doesn't come apart nicely. There were no screws, was just a matter of brute force breaking the plastic. In the process I trashed the circuitry and broke off the aux audio output jack.
Figured I'd get a little bit of satisfaction by posting a photo. I set the aux audio output jack back on the board to make it look like it should if disassembled less destructively.
